Our research group studies immune markers in the human genital mucosa and how these influence susceptibility to sexually transmitted infections. We use advanced molecular biology and bioinformatics techniques and integrate these data with results from image analysis of tissue biopsies.
Your tasks will include experimental handling of human mucosal samples, including immunostaining, scanning, and quantitative evaluation. You will also perform data processing of these results, focusing on quantifying phenotypic cell markers complemented by structural markers. Part of the position will take place within the healthcare setting, with coordination responsibilities for recruiting study participants, sample collection, and gathering clinical and anamnesis data.
